The mysterious Charles Hooker

Charles Hooker was the father of Herbert Roswell Hooker and the great grandfather of Neal Hooker. But who was the father of Charles Hooker? Was Charles the son of William Farrar Hooker and born in 1813? Or, was he the son of Charles Joseph Hooker born in 1818? In either case, the lineage can be traced back to the Reverend Thomas Hooker, just through different sons of Samuel Hooker.

Only one of them is the Charles Hooker who was married to Melita Shepherd who together produced a significant number of interesting Hookers, including a Charles Hooker. I am not sure that I can provide a definitive answer, but there are some clues. The problem is compounded by what appears to be sloppy genealogy. It is necessary to remember that there are a large number of people who religiously record the historical records of individuals. If the sources are missing or inaccurate, the evidence is only as good as the vigilance of the recorder. Then the problem gets compounded by others copying and spreading shoddy work.

To put it suscinctly, there were 2 Charles Hooker, both born in New York to two different parents. Only one of them married Metita Ann Shepard. Which one?

William Farrar Hooker

Willliam Farrar Hooker is a possible, in fact probable, father of Charles, husband of Melita Shepard:

  • According to Edward Hooker, The Descendants of Rev. Thomas Hooker, William Farrar Hooker was the son of Daniel Hooker and Mary Sedgwick. Assuming that Edward listed Daniel’s children in birth order as was his practice, and assuming that there was at least 2 years between the children, William was born sometime between 1776 and 1780. The Charles we are interested in was born either 1813 or 1818 and it is perfectly credible that William Farrar could have been the father of either.
  • William was born in West Hartford, Connecticut as were all of his siblings. Both his mother and father died in West Hartford.
